Residential Litigation Associate – Manchester
An excellent opportunity has arisen for a Senior Associate to join one of the leading residential property disputes teams in the UK. This International and Top50 Legal500 firm is looking to strengthen its team.
This specialist team is recognised for its expertise in residential leasehold management, enfranchisement, Right to Manage and building safety matters, advising a broad range of landlords, developers, housing providers, management companies and managing agents.
Due to continued growth and an increasing volume of instructions, the team is looking to appoint an experienced lawyer to play a key role in its ongoing development.
The Role
You will advise on a broad range of residential property disputes matters including:
- Residential leasehold management disputes
- Service charge disputes
- Enfranchisement claims
- Right to Manage matters
- Forfeiture and possession proceedings
- Building Safety Act and remediation issues
- Residential landlord and tenant disputes
- Estate management disputes
- Rights of way, restrictive covenants and adverse possession matters
The team advises a diverse client base across the private, public and social housing sectors and is widely recognised as a market leader in this specialist area.
Alongside fee-earning responsibilities, you will supervise junior lawyers, develop client relationships and contribute to business development initiatives across the North West market.
